Hippos

 

Pronunciation:  HIH-pos

Occurrences:  3

First Reference:  Yeshua 10:49

 

Then came Yeshua down unto the sea at evening tide, and sending away the multitudes, he entered a boat; for he desired to cross over unto the other side, unto Hippos a city of Decapolis.

 

 

See:  Decapolis, Demitrius, Regilla

 

Summary:  Located on the eastern shore of the Sea of Galilee, Hippos was one of the ten cities included among the Decapolis. While teaching in Hippos, Yeshua was invited to the house of a famous artisan named Demitrius, who later became one of Yeshua’s most devoted disciples (Y:10:59-83).

 

Also from Hippos was the woman, Regilla. She is listed among women who had been healed by Yeshua and were counted among his discipleship (Y:11:1-3).
